查看运行的程序linux命令
-
要查看在Linux系统中正在运行的程序,可以使用以下命令:
1. ps命令:ps是”process status”的缩写,用于显示当前运行的进程。
使用ps命令可以查看系统中所有正在运行的进程。可以使用不同的选项来获取不同的信息,例如:
– ps aux:显示所有进程的详细信息,包括用户、CPU使用率、内存使用情况等。
– ps -ef:显示所有进程的详细信息,包括进程树结构。
– ps aux | grep <关键字>:根据关键字过滤出相关的进程。
2. top命令:top命令可以实时动态地显示系统中运行的进程信息,以及系统的整体状态。
使用top命令可以查看进程的详细信息,包括CPU使用率、内存使用情况、进程ID等。
在top命令中可以按不同的键来进行排序、过滤和刷新操作,例如:
– 按键盘上的数字键1,可以按CPU占用率进行排序。
– 按键盘上的字母键f,可以显示或隐藏不同的列。
– 按键盘上的字母键q,可以退出top命令。
3. htop命令:htop命令是top命令的一个改进版本,在终端中使用htop命令可以以更友好的方式显示进程信息。
htop命令提供了鼠标操作和键盘快捷键,使得查看进程信息更加方便和直观。
以上是在Linux系统中查看正在运行的程序的一些常用命令,可以根据实际需求选择合适的命令来获取所需的信息。
2年前 -
在Linux系统中,有多个命令可以查看正在运行的程序。以下是五个常见的命令:
1. `ps`命令:使用`ps`命令可以查看当前运行的进程。默认情况下,`ps`命令只会显示与当前终端会话关联的进程,使用`-e`选项可以显示所有进程。例如,使用`ps -e`命令可以列出所有运行的进程。此外,`ps`命令还有许多选项可以对进程进行排序、过滤等操作。
2. `top`命令:`top`命令可以实时显示系统中运行的进程和系统性能。它以交互式方式显示进程列表,按CPU利用率或内存使用情况等排序。通过查看`top`命令的输出,可以了解系统中CPU、内存、磁盘等资源的使用情况。
3. `htop`命令:`htop`命令是`top`命令的改进版,提供了更直观、更易用的界面。与`top`命令类似,`htop`也可以实时显示运行的进程和系统状态。可以使用包管理器安装`htop`,例如在Ubuntu上可以使用`apt`命令:`sudo apt install htop`。
4. `pstree`命令:使用`pstree`命令可以以树状结构显示进程间的关系。该命令会从init进程开始,逐级显示子进程,帮助用户了解进程的层次结构。例如,使用`pstree -p`命令可以显示进程ID(PID)。
5. `lsof`命令:`lsof`命令用于显示正在使用某个文件或者网络连接的进程。可以使用`-i`选项查看与网络相关的进程,使用`-r`选项递归显示进程信息。例如,使用`lsof -i :80`命令可以查看占用80端口的进程。
综上所述,以上是五个查看运行的程序的Linux命令。每个命令都有自己的特点和用途,可以根据实际需求选择适合的命令来查看运行的程序。
2年前 -
在Linux系统中,可以使用一些命令来查看正在运行的程序。以下是几个常用的命令:
1. `ps`命令:
`ps`命令可以列出当前运行的进程。常用的选项有:
– `aux`:列出所有进程的详细信息,包括进程的用户、CPU使用率、内存使用情况等。
– `ef`:以树状结构的形式显示进程间的关系。
– `f`:以嵌套关系的形式显示进程间的关系。示例:
“`
ps aux # 列出所有进程的详细信息
ps -ef # 以树状结构显示进程间的关系
ps -f # 以嵌套关系显示进程间的关系
“`2. `top`命令:
`top`命令可以实时地显示系统中运行的进程和系统资源的使用情况,包括CPU、内存、I/O等。默认情况下,`top`命令按照CPU使用率从高到低排序进程。示例:
“`
top # 实时显示系统中运行的进程和资源使用情况
“`3. `htop`命令:
`htop`命令是`top`命令的增强版本,提供了更丰富的功能和交互界面。可以通过`htop`命令查看正在运行的进程,并可以以不同的颜色和进程状态来显示。示例:
“`
htop # 查看正在运行的进程并以交互式界面显示
“`4. `pgrep`命令:
`pgrep`命令可以通过进程名或进程ID来查找进程。它将根据指定的模式返回匹配的进程ID。示例:
“`
pgrep process_name # 查找指定进程名的进程ID
pgrep -u username # 查找指定用户的所有进程ID
“`5. `pstree`命令:
`pstree`命令可以以树状结构的形式显示进程间的关系。示例:
“`
pstree # 显示当前系统中所有进程的树状结构
“`总结:
以上是在Linux系统中查看正在运行的程序的几个常用命令。根据实际需求选择合适的命令来查看进程信息和系统资源使用情况。2年前